Cape Town Cycle Tour warn of strong winds on Sunday


News bot

Recommended Posts

We have been advised that there is a high probability of severe winds on the Cape Peninsula within the next 24 hours. We strongly urge Cape Town Cycle Tour participants who are either not comfortable or do not have experience riding in strong winds, to carefully consider their decision to participate tomorrow. We believe wind conditions will not be as strong as in 2009, but they will nevertheless be severe. Cyclists and spectators must please take note.
